Your image is printed photographically and bonded to a 3.5mm thick, Dibond board (black polyethylene sandwiched between two sheets of white coated aluminium). The panel is then sealed with a gloss protective covering. Supplied complete with a wall mount which holds the print 10mm from the wall.

This print showcases the distinguished figure of Sir Fitzroy Kelly, an eminent English Judge and Attorney General. The portrait captures his commanding presence and intellectual prowess, reflecting his influential role in the legal system during the 19th century. Engraved by D. J. Pound from a photograph taken by Mayall, this image is a testament to the artistry of both artists involved in its creation. The intricate details etched into the engraving highlight Sir Fitzroy Kelly's sharp features, conveying a sense of wisdom and authority. Published in London in 1859 as part of "The Drawing-Room Portrait Gallery of Eminent Personages" this historical artifact provides us with a glimpse into Victorian society's fascination with notable figures. It serves as a reminder of how portraiture was not only used for personal admiration but also as a means to document important individuals who shaped their respective fields.
